Web15 mrt. 2016 Β· Algebra Quadratic Equations and Functions Comparing Methods for Solving Quadratics 1 Answer Noah G Mar 15, 2016 You can first factor out an x from each term to the left of the =. Explanation: x(x2 βx β 12) = 0 Solve by factoring: x(x β4)(x +3) = 0 x = 0,4 and β 3 Hopefully this helps.
